What we found

Most residents praise the leasing and maintenance staff by name (Hailee, Chelsea, Brent, Dante), noting quick response times and attentive service. The property stays clean, the dog park and pool work well, and the Goat restaurant on-site is popular. Pflugerville location puts you 20 minutes from downtown but close to shopping and movies.

However, some flag serious issues: unauthorized vehicle tows charged back to residents, management's harsh handling of damage disputes (one resident charged despite no negligence finding after a garage fire), and inconsistent pet cleanup enforcement. The minority of negative reviews suggest management's fairness and communication break down when problems escalate.

FAQ

How quickly does maintenance respond?
One resident reported a maintenance issue resolved in under 24 hours. Staff Brent and Dante are noted for timely fixes, though HVAC issues during Texas heat can take longer.
What are pet fees?
Their website lists a $20 per-pet monthly rental fee and a $300 non-refundable pet administration fee per pet.
Is there a dog park?
Yes, the community has a dog park. Note: one resident reported inconsistent pet waste cleanup by other owners.
